  6. I've thought this exact thing many times over.
    Chasing all the 'pedals of the moment' that people rave about either here or on talk bass.
    I've found that, for me, very very few actually live up to the hype. (Inc source, boutique brands, and some of the ehx products)
    The boss offerings, as well as the ampeg inspired ones don't work for me. It has cost me an absolute fortune over the years!!
    The ones I've had the best results with are the bass soul food, bass tubescreamer, dod bass overdrive, cream pie for subtle drive and the glove for lemmy grind
    I don't have much use for full on drive/ distortion tones- so I don't have anything on my boards at the moment to cover that.
